SnapshotPropertiesOutput interface
Eigenschaften der Momentaufnahmeressource.
Eigenschaften
completion |
Prozentsatz abgeschlossen für die Hintergrundkopie, wenn eine Ressource über den CopyStart-Vorgang erstellt wird. |
copy |
Gibt die Fehlerdetails an, wenn die Hintergrundkopie einer Ressource, die über den CopyStart-Vorgang erstellt wurde, fehlschlägt. |
creation |
Informationen zur Datenträgerquelle. CreationData-Informationen können nach dem Erstellen des Datenträgers nicht mehr geändert werden. |
data |
Zusätzliche Authentifizierungsanforderungen beim Exportieren oder Hochladen auf einen Datenträger oder eine Momentaufnahme. |
disk |
ARM-ID der DiskAccess-Ressource für die Verwendung privater Endpunkte auf Datenträgern. |
disk |
Die Größe des Datenträgers in Bytes. Dieses Feld ist schreibgeschützt. |
disk |
Wenn creationData.createOption leer ist, ist dieses Feld obligatorisch und gibt die Größe des zu erstellenden Datenträgers an. Wenn dieses Feld für Updates oder Die Erstellung mit anderen Optionen vorhanden ist, gibt es eine Größenänderung an. Größenänderungen sind nur zulässig, wenn der Datenträger nicht an eine ausgeführte VM angefügt ist und die Größe des Datenträgers nur erhöhen kann. |
disk |
Der Status der Momentaufnahme. |
encryption | Die Verschlüsselungseigenschaft kann verwendet werden, um ruhende Daten mit kundenseitig oder plattformseitig verwalteten Schlüsseln zu verschlüsseln. |
encryption |
Die Sammlung von Verschlüsselungseinstellungen, die als Azure Disk Encryption verwendet wird, kann mehrere Verschlüsselungseinstellungen pro Datenträger oder Momentaufnahme enthalten. |
hyper |
Die Hypervisorgenerierung des virtuellen Computers. Gilt nur für Betriebssystemdatenträger. |
incremental | Gibt an, ob eine Momentaufnahme inkrementell ist. Inkrementelle Momentaufnahmen auf demselben Datenträger belegen weniger Speicherplatz als vollständige Momentaufnahmen und können unterschiedlich sein. |
incremental |
Inkrementelle Momentaufnahmen für einen Datenträger teilen eine inkrementelle Momentaufnahmefamilien-ID. Die Get Page Range Diff-API kann nur für inkrementelle Momentaufnahmen mit derselben Familien-ID aufgerufen werden. |
network |
Richtlinie für den Zugriff auf den Datenträger über das Netzwerk. |
os |
Der Betriebssystemtyp. |
provisioning |
Der Bereitstellungsstatus des Datenträgers. |
public |
Richtlinie zum Steuern des Exports auf dem Datenträger. |
purchase |
Kaufplaninformationen für das Image, aus dem der Quelldatenträger für die Momentaufnahme ursprünglich erstellt wurde. |
security |
Enthält die sicherheitsbezogenen Informationen für die Ressource. |
supported |
Liste der unterstützten Funktionen für das Image, aus dem der Quelldatenträger aus der Momentaufnahme ursprünglich erstellt wurde. |
supports |
Gibt an, dass das Betriebssystem in einer Momentaufnahme den Ruhezustand unterstützt. |
time |
Der Zeitpunkt, zu dem die Momentaufnahme erstellt wurde. |
unique |
Eindeutige GUID, die die Ressource identifiziert. |
Details zur Eigenschaft
completionPercent
Prozentsatz abgeschlossen für die Hintergrundkopie, wenn eine Ressource über den CopyStart-Vorgang erstellt wird.
completionPercent?: number
Eigenschaftswert
number
copyCompletionError
Gibt die Fehlerdetails an, wenn die Hintergrundkopie einer Ressource, die über den CopyStart-Vorgang erstellt wurde, fehlschlägt.
copyCompletionError?: CopyCompletionErrorOutput
Eigenschaftswert
creationData
Informationen zur Datenträgerquelle. CreationData-Informationen können nach dem Erstellen des Datenträgers nicht mehr geändert werden.
creationData: CreationDataOutput
Eigenschaftswert
dataAccessAuthMode
Zusätzliche Authentifizierungsanforderungen beim Exportieren oder Hochladen auf einen Datenträger oder eine Momentaufnahme.
dataAccessAuthMode?: "None" | "AzureActiveDirectory"
Eigenschaftswert
"None" | "AzureActiveDirectory"
diskAccessId
ARM-ID der DiskAccess-Ressource für die Verwendung privater Endpunkte auf Datenträgern.
diskAccessId?: string
Eigenschaftswert
string
diskSizeBytes
Die Größe des Datenträgers in Bytes. Dieses Feld ist schreibgeschützt.
diskSizeBytes?: number
Eigenschaftswert
number
diskSizeGB
Wenn creationData.createOption leer ist, ist dieses Feld obligatorisch und gibt die Größe des zu erstellenden Datenträgers an. Wenn dieses Feld für Updates oder Die Erstellung mit anderen Optionen vorhanden ist, gibt es eine Größenänderung an. Größenänderungen sind nur zulässig, wenn der Datenträger nicht an eine ausgeführte VM angefügt ist und die Größe des Datenträgers nur erhöhen kann.
diskSizeGB?: number
Eigenschaftswert
number
diskState
Der Status der Momentaufnahme.
diskState?: "Unattached" | "Attached" | "Reserved" | "Frozen" | "ActiveSAS" | "ActiveSASFrozen" | "ReadyToUpload" | "ActiveUpload"
Eigenschaftswert
"Unattached" | "Attached" | "Reserved" | "Frozen" | "ActiveSAS" | "ActiveSASFrozen" | "ReadyToUpload" | "ActiveUpload"
encryption
Die Verschlüsselungseigenschaft kann verwendet werden, um ruhende Daten mit kundenseitig oder plattformseitig verwalteten Schlüsseln zu verschlüsseln.
encryption?: EncryptionOutput
Eigenschaftswert
encryptionSettingsCollection
Die Sammlung von Verschlüsselungseinstellungen, die als Azure Disk Encryption verwendet wird, kann mehrere Verschlüsselungseinstellungen pro Datenträger oder Momentaufnahme enthalten.
encryptionSettingsCollection?: EncryptionSettingsCollectionOutput
Eigenschaftswert
hyperVGeneration
Die Hypervisorgenerierung des virtuellen Computers. Gilt nur für Betriebssystemdatenträger.
hyperVGeneration?: "V1" | "V2"
Eigenschaftswert
"V1" | "V2"
incremental
Gibt an, ob eine Momentaufnahme inkrementell ist. Inkrementelle Momentaufnahmen auf demselben Datenträger belegen weniger Speicherplatz als vollständige Momentaufnahmen und können unterschiedlich sein.
incremental?: boolean
Eigenschaftswert
boolean
incrementalSnapshotFamilyId
Inkrementelle Momentaufnahmen für einen Datenträger teilen eine inkrementelle Momentaufnahmefamilien-ID. Die Get Page Range Diff-API kann nur für inkrementelle Momentaufnahmen mit derselben Familien-ID aufgerufen werden.
incrementalSnapshotFamilyId?: string
Eigenschaftswert
string
networkAccessPolicy
Richtlinie für den Zugriff auf den Datenträger über das Netzwerk.
networkAccessPolicy?: "AllowAll" | "AllowPrivate" | "DenyAll"
Eigenschaftswert
"AllowAll" | "AllowPrivate" | "DenyAll"
osType
Der Betriebssystemtyp.
osType?: "Windows" | "Linux"
Eigenschaftswert
"Windows" | "Linux"
provisioningState
Der Bereitstellungsstatus des Datenträgers.
provisioningState?: string
Eigenschaftswert
string
publicNetworkAccess
Richtlinie zum Steuern des Exports auf dem Datenträger.
publicNetworkAccess?: "Enabled" | "Disabled"
Eigenschaftswert
"Enabled" | "Disabled"
purchasePlan
Kaufplaninformationen für das Image, aus dem der Quelldatenträger für die Momentaufnahme ursprünglich erstellt wurde.
purchasePlan?: PurchasePlanAutoGeneratedOutput
Eigenschaftswert
securityProfile
Enthält die sicherheitsbezogenen Informationen für die Ressource.
securityProfile?: DiskSecurityProfileOutput
Eigenschaftswert
supportedCapabilities
Liste der unterstützten Funktionen für das Image, aus dem der Quelldatenträger aus der Momentaufnahme ursprünglich erstellt wurde.
supportedCapabilities?: SupportedCapabilitiesOutput
Eigenschaftswert
supportsHibernation
Gibt an, dass das Betriebssystem in einer Momentaufnahme den Ruhezustand unterstützt.
supportsHibernation?: boolean
Eigenschaftswert
boolean
timeCreated
Der Zeitpunkt, zu dem die Momentaufnahme erstellt wurde.
timeCreated?: string
Eigenschaftswert
string
uniqueId
Eindeutige GUID, die die Ressource identifiziert.
uniqueId?: string
Eigenschaftswert
string
Azure SDK for JavaScript